After graduation with Outstanding Distinction from The London School Contemporary Dance Julian joined the world famous London Contemporary Dance Theatre, under the direction of Robert Cohan, dancing throughout the world, appearing in two Olympic Arts Festivals, the American Dance Festival's 50th Anniversary, amongst countless other touring dates.

During this time with LCDT he also appeared with Peter Sparling and dancers (a soloist from the Martha Graham Company), Jane Dudley and dancers, Ingegard Lönroth and dancers, and The English Bach Festival and was heavily involved with the education department, teaching for the company all over the United Kingdom and helping to devise their programme.At the invitation of the Director John McFall Julian then joined Ballet Met in the USA as Guest Artist for their 1989 season, dancing now in a classical repertory with work from Blalanchine, Smuin, Taylor, Taylor-Corbett and creating two roles in a new work by James Kudelka. Returning to London he re-joined LCDT for a short period under the new direction of director Dan Wagoner.From 1989 he has worked as Robert North's assistant staging his work all over the world.

Companies include Ballet Met, Göteborg Ballet, National Ballet of Canada, La Scala Milan, Hannover Ballet, Toulouse Ballet, Colorado Ballet, Milwuakee Ballet, Tulsa Ballet, Sarasota Ballet, Komische Oper Berlin, Ballet De Santiago, Oper Leipzig, Bern Ballet, Semper Oper Dresden, Ankara Ballet, Louisville Ballet, San Carlo Ballet, Scottish Ballet amongst others.In 1991 Julian was asked by Christopher Gable to join Ballet Central as Associate Artistic Director leading an 18 week tour of the UK.Later that year Julian joined Göteborg Ballet as soloist and Ballet Master.Jullian also worked at University College of Dance in Stockholm between 1998 and 2005 where he was appointed Guest Professor.Julian has aslo created 25 works commissioned by schools and professional companies alike.
